]> git.sesse.net Git - ffmpeg/blobdiff - libavfilter/asink_anullsink.c
vf_blackframe: switch to filter_frame
[ffmpeg] / libavfilter / asink_anullsink.c
index 7b337e630ea491b04005a2ae0885b1e20265f6ee..5a324fccf08b06bccfcb351514cb157cb77154ef 100644 (file)
@@ -22,8 +22,9 @@
 #include "avfilter.h"
 #include "internal.h"
 
-static int null_filter_samples(AVFilterLink *link, AVFilterBufferRef *samplesref)
+static int null_filter_frame(AVFilterLink *link, AVFilterBufferRef *samplesref)
 {
+    avfilter_unref_bufferp(&samplesref);
     return 0;
 }
 
@@ -31,7 +32,7 @@ static const AVFilterPad avfilter_asink_anullsink_inputs[] = {
     {
         .name           = "default",
         .type           = AVMEDIA_TYPE_AUDIO,
-        .filter_samples = null_filter_samples,
+        .filter_frame   = null_filter_frame,
     },
     { NULL },
 };